Facts about Seven Kings

Seven Kings is a district in East London, located within the London Borough of Redbridge and historically part of the county of Essex. The name ‘Seven Kings’ is thought to derive from a local legend that seven Anglo-Saxon kings once met at a local stream, although historical records suggest it may come from a personal name, ‘Seofocingas’. The area is home to Seven Kings Park, a large and popular green space that features a lake, tennis courts, and sports pitches, providing a vital recreational area for the local community. The district developed rapidly in the late 19th and early 20th centuries as a middle-class suburb following the expansion of the Great Eastern Railway. Seven Kings railway station is now a major transport hub on the Elizabeth Line, providing fast and direct connections to Central London, Heathrow, and Reading, which has spurred recent residential development in the area. The High Road (A118) is the main commercial thoroughfare, featuring a vibrant and diverse array of shops, restaurants, and businesses that reflect the area’s multicultural population. Historically, the area was part of the manor of Ilford and remained largely agricultural until the arrival of the railway. Westwood Park is another local green space that offers a quieter environment for residents away from the busy main roads. The housing stock is a rich mix of Victorian and Edwardian terraced houses, many of which retain original features such as stained glass and ornate brickwork, alongside newer apartment complexes. The area has a strong community spirit, often centred around the local primary and secondary schools, which are a major draw for families moving to the area. Seven Kings High School is a highly regarded educational institution that serves the local population and contributes to the area’s family-friendly reputation. Historically, the Seven Kings Water, a local stream, was an important feature of the landscape and gave the area its name. The district is bordered by Ilford to the west and Goodmayes to the east, creating a continuous urban corridor along the High Road. Seven Kings has seen various regeneration projects aimed at improving the streetscape and transport infrastructure to accommodate the growth driven by the Elizabeth Line. The area retains a distinct suburban character, offering a balance of transport connectivity, green space, and a vibrant community life.
